His Majesty's Yacht Britannia, a gaff-rigged cutter built in 1893, was crafted for Albert Edward, Prince of Wales, who later became King Edward VII, and his son, King George V. As a racing vessel, she dominated the regatta circuits, securing over 230 wins in her illustrious career. Remarkably, upon King George V's death, he requested her to be scuttled, ensuring she'd never sail without him. She now rests off the Isle of Wight, immortalized in maritime history.
